Didn't look like it had really been mentioned here so figured I would. When you ding 39 a great place to go is the second of the two grimling mines in TM (the one closest to Katta). To be honest I can't remember if they have pp but the runes and gems they drop make up for that with some runes selling for over 4pp each. Of the two mines this second one has the following advantages over the other (that I have seen) - increased drop rates on gems and runes, single pull mobs, more mobs, grimling runner stop. The first cave has double static spawns that will only really single pull once the ore dudes are lt blue baring some other grouped form of single pulling. I 2 box with a Druid bot but want to say my pet (with only haste and proc) was able to take down a grimling by himself with little problem so should be a good solo spot. The two mobs at the ent both path to the left so if you are trying to break in would start on the left side of the left mob. I set up shop on top of the first spawn point inside the cave. That led to fighting 4 mobs back to back though so you will have to watch out and plan accordingly. The reason for 4 is the spawn point I was sitting on would pop and then start to walk out of the cave at 20%, which would argo 1 of the two ent guards. Fighting there would usually argo the 2nd guard and just about the time that was done the 1 wondering mob would make her entrance. Anyway, that is just how I had things. The wandering mob does path outside the cave just a bit so it is an option to take her out outside.

There is a caster class (females) and they like to cast back to back DD spells. With 2 boxed healer it wasn't a problem but for soloer a technique that would probably work well (I tested it some) would be to send the pet in and THEN start casting vs the other way around. Typically they cast 3 or 4 spells which should be done by the time you hit her with slow, DoT, and nuke. They do like to cast a snare type spell also FYI. Grim Foremen have more hps then the other two so you will have to play that one by ear. They can drop the master's enchilada and you will see it if they have it.

Last but not least is the Grimling runner who I think is on a one hour spawn timer will come into the cave to the first inside spawn. He of course is the holder of the no drop Rallic pack quest item. The mobs start to go lt blue at 43 I think but isn't a bad place at all for a while after that as there are like 15 mobs in this cave. Bring lots o bags.

Can you give me some idea of your equip (or at least AC, HPs, resists) and what, if any, buffs you had (not your own but others like Temp, C, whatever) when you did the Grim mines?

Following your guide I went to Ten. To the 1st little mine coming from Katta. There were 2 entrance Grims, 1 just inside past entrance in corner. In the next corner another and 2 to the right of that one down a little. When you get inside there's 1 room kind of split in 2 parts with 3 Grim in right section and another 3 in the other.  Am I in the right mine as referenced in post?

Well I pulled an Orefinder from outside and pet and I tore him up in no time so I'm thinking "damn that post is right on these things are a piece of cake". Didn't look at xp at that point so not sure how good/bad it might have been since I was figuring "these are so easy even if only 20% of a blue per I'll go through a ton of them". Next I pull the other outside guard, a Geomancer, she hits me with a 246HP & 100+ nuke then comes running, pet and I take her out but I'm down 30% health (from nukes and little melee she did).

I'm still not worried cause they die so quick. I heal to 100% and go inside. Another Orefinder in 1st corner, yank him close to entrance and kill him easy. Next corner (and 2 near her) are all Geomancers (Wizards). The corner one looks far enough away that it looked like a single pull. Well I hit her with a Drowsy and send pet on her. I start seeing a bunch of nuke msgs and look at the 2 near one I tried to pull. Both are casting on me. I turn to bail out, now at like 30%, and get hit with 2-3 more nukes and die.
Anyway, I tried 2 more times, died once more and barely made Katta zone a 3rd. My resists are all in the low-high 60s with my resist buffs on, not great I know but I'm thinking not bad for the lvl. Those Wizzys tore me up. Also tried the "send pet in" suggestion. They still all cast on me instead of the pet.

I'm thinking this could be a sweet spot if I can survive it. I eventually got  inside (son brought his Druid and wiped the Wizzys for me) and it looks managable but, as stated, I can't handle the 3 Wizzys. Even when I got them split, by the time I finish the inside mobs, healed/meded, and started the cycle again, the 3 had respawned.

What am I missing?  Any advice/info. greatly appreciated.  I'm L42 btw.

I spent some time here at those levels, but I don't think ever solo unfortunately.  One thing to watch out for would be wanderers...I think there are a few non-static mobs that might mess up your pulling.  Wait and observe a bit next time perhaps?

Buy some pet toys too...with the money you make in this camp you could definitely afford it...the extra hp and dps your pet will do should make things a lot easier, let your pet do the tanking when you get multiples.  Oh wait, you did that...and you still kept aggro...my suggestion is to send pet in before you cast anything at all.  It seems to me that casters will often cast on the first thing that aggros them even if something else gets aggro later.  Perhaps that's what you did, in which case...not sure what to say.
